Burly, strong center/guard prospect whose strengths lend themselves to a fit with a power-based rushing attack. Hines can create run lanes as an aggressive drive blocker and is effective hitting targets on the move on pin-and-pull reps. He needs to drop some weight and improve his hand placement in order to sustain blocks as a pro. He protects the pocket with decent technique but might not have enough mirror to keep the gaps clean as a full-time guard. Hines has early backup value along the interior line with eventual starting talent that is best-suited at the center spot.
